Brief Summary

Review the sponsor-provided synopsis that highlights what the study is about and why it is being conducted.

The growing demand for white smile between patients has increased over recent years, the development of techniques and improvement of materials permits searching for beautiful natural smile.

The discoloration of teeth might be intrinsic, extrinsic, or combined. A variety of commercial bleaching agents is available. The most common substances used are carbamide peroxide or hydrogen peroxide or a mixture of sodium perborate and hydrogen peroxide.

Detailed Description

Dive into the extended narrative that explains the scientific background, objectives, and procedures in greater depth.

The aim of the study is to assess the effectiveness of two different in-office bleaching materials carbamide peroxide alone and carbamide peroxide with Chitosan nanoparticles Using diode laser as an activator Regarding tooth whitening and color stability 1 Day , 1 weeks, 1 month after treatment using Vita easy shade.

Eligibility Criteria

Check the participation requirements, including inclusion and exclusion rules, age limits, and whether healthy volunteers are accepted.

Inclusion Criteria

* discolored crown, non-vital or endodontically treated upper central and lateral incisors
* previous endodontic treatment performed two or more years earlier.

Exclusion Criteria

* caries on upper central and lateral incisors, inadequate fillings, and progressive periodontal disease.
